It's amazing how mankind whispers cruelty, gossips, destroys character, walks around discriminating,  deprecating, depreciating, isolating, forming clicks.  If you don't hold their agenda, they ignore you, look pass you, like you don't exist.  Or, you receive a cold hard stare as you don't comply with their expectations!  And then they shake their head and wonder why the suicide rate is so high! I would like to say that my heart hasn't felt this way.  I have shunned and have been shunned, more than once in life.  God boldly says that if you don't love your brother, the love of the Father is not in you.  OUCH!! 

I have had folks tell me they really didn't know who God is, or questioned his existence? 

Heart Homework:  John 4:7-8 

Well, I can surely tell you what God isn't, just by my own heart bangs that echo, this is NOT love!  When Jesus was here on earth, he never whispered cruel things about other people.  He never gossiped,  He never destroyed someone's character by spreading false rumors.  He never discriminated against anyone.  Matthew 19:14.  He never caused sickness, but healed sickness.  He would edify and not depreciate, isolate and never had clicks.  He called all unto him, He said, "come unto me ye who are heavy laden, and I will give you rest.  God's love shows no favoritism; it is so large it is capable of covering all. Act 10:34. and Job 34:19. 

I think the reason we are here is for a purpose and the purpose is to show His love through how we treat and speak to others, like a bright, burning candle, speaking truth in LOVE!  I can only live through His saving grace.  My imperfection is covered by my Savior's perfection!  My prayer is that God takes my words that are not healing and turns them into words of healing and edification.  

Some folks think you can do good by yourself, without having a loving, guide (Holy Spirit) to help you through the maze.  They think they can do without someone to forgive them, when their decisions have shattered their soul.  Someone to be there when you don't meet the world's expectations.  Even in the academic, circular world we need guidance.  Where or what would we be without teachers?   

I have met the teacher of all teachers!  And I am here again, sitting at His feet, asking for guidance in the way I live, the way I talk and most of all in the way I love!
